Global Nanocrystal Packaging Coatings Market to Reach US$242.8 Million by 2030

The global market for Nanocrystal Packaging Coatings estimated at US$193.0 Million in the year 2024, is expected to reach US$242.8 Million by 2030, growing at a CAGR of 3.9% over the analysis period 2024-2030. Barrier Coatings, one of the segments analyzed in the report, is expected to record a 3.9% CAGR and reach US$102.8 Million by the end of the analysis period. Growth in the Antibacterial Coatings segment is estimated at 5.1% CAGR over the analysis period.

The U.S. Market is Estimated at US$52.6 Million While China is Forecast to Grow at 7.2% CAGR

The Nanocrystal Packaging Coatings market in the U.S. is estimated at US$52.6 Million in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$49.1 Million by the year 2030 trailing a CAGR of 7.2%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 1.6% and 3.0%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 2.2% CAGR.

Global Nanocrystal Packaging Coatings Market - Key Trends & Drivers Summarized

What Are Nanocrystal Packaging Coatings, and Why Are They Gaining Traction?

Nanocrystal packaging coatings represent a revolutionary advancement in materials science, leveraging nanoscale crystal technologies to enhance the properties of packaging materials. These coatings are particularly valued for their ability to provide exceptional barrier properties, ensuring product integrity and longevity. They serve critical roles in industries such as food and beverage, pharmaceuticals, and cosmetics, where maintaining freshness and preventing contamination are paramount. The rise of e-commerce has further fueled demand for these coatings, as packaging durability and aesthetics become crucial in consumer decision-making. Furthermore, regulatory mandates promoting sustainability and biodegradable solutions have accelerated the adoption of nanocrystal coatings that are eco-friendly yet high-performing.

What Are the Emerging Applications Driving Market Growth?

The applications of nanocrystal packaging coatings extend far beyond traditional packaging requirements. In the food and beverage sector, these coatings help combat spoilage and extend shelf life by creating impenetrable barriers against oxygen, moisture, and UV rays. In pharmaceuticals, nanocrystal coatings are enabling advancements in smart packaging solutions, including drug stability and tamper-proof mechanisms. Cosmetics and personal care industries are also leveraging these coatings to enhance product aesthetics and improve resistance to degradation caused by light and air exposure. With ongoing research, nanocrystal coatings are increasingly being integrated with antimicrobial and self-healing properties, opening new avenues for high-tech applications across industries.

How Is Technology Shaping the Future of This Market?

Technological innovation remains a pivotal force in shaping the trajectory of the nanocrystal packaging coatings market. Advances in nanotechnology have led to the development of multifunctional coatings that combine mechanical strength, barrier protection, and eco-friendly attributes. Companies are also focusing on scaling production technologies to reduce costs, making nanocrystal coatings more accessible to small and medium-sized enterprises. Smart packaging solutions, such as coatings embedded with sensors for real-time monitoring of product conditions, are emerging as a major trend, particularly in the pharmaceutical and perishable goods sectors. The integration of artificial intelligence and machine learning to optimize coating formulations and predict performance is further enhancing the market’s capabilities.

What Is Driving Growth in the Nanocrystal Packaging Coatings Market?

The growth in the nanocrystal packaging coatings market is driven by several factors, including increasing consumer awareness of sustainable and environmentally friendly packaging solutions. Regulatory bodies worldwide are enforcing stringent guidelines to minimize plastic waste, encouraging the use of advanced, biodegradable nanocrystal coatings. The surging demand for longer shelf life in food and beverage products is another critical growth driver, as manufacturers seek reliable solutions to reduce food waste. Additionally, the expansion of the e-commerce industry has created unprecedented demand for durable, lightweight, and visually appealing packaging. Consumer preferences for premium and aesthetically pleasing packaging in personal care and cosmetics further amplify the market’s momentum. Overall, the convergence of technological, regulatory, and consumer trends is positioning nanocrystal packaging coatings as a cornerstone of future packaging innovations.
